Short summary
Agent projects stall after launch not due to model capability but missing operational infrastructure. The article contrasts stalled teams (shared API keys, no invocation logging, no audit trails) with operating teams that have per-agent identity, declarative tool permissions, durable session observability, and real-time compliance readiness. It argues for a purpose-built agent control plane between applications and runtimes.
- •79% of enterprises adopt agents but only 31% run them reliably in production
- •Stalled teams lack per-agent identity, invocation logging, and audit trails
- •A control plane layer manages lifecycle, credentials, policy enforcement, and cost attribution
